I also figured out that online multiplayer is broken on native version of Linux, you have to enable proton (I use proton experimental) for it to work normally

Matrix is also foss but it is safer and decentralised. From my experience revolt is more buggy and is hosted on one server which means that if that server goes offline then no one can use revolt, if one of matrix servers went down people could still use it by switching instance
